The Body Shop Body Mist Review
The Body Ship Satsuma Body Mist ($12 Each) is one of several new scented fragrances from the Body Shop.
I haven’t been following The Body Shop closely lately so I was kinda surprised and delighted when I came across these body mists while out on a shopping date with some friends. These are available in 3.3 oz glass spritzer bottles in a range of eight scents. Most of the scents are old favorites from the Body Shop like Satsuma and Strawberry.
I commonly associate the scent of Satsuma with the Body Shop. They always have the oil burning in the store and it’s the first thing that hits you in the face when you walk in. It’s a scent that has always been readily available in the body collection but never as a fragrance.

These are fabulous. My friends picked up Vanilla and Coconut which are both gorgeous. I was only interested in Satsuma to be honest as it’s always been such a bright, happy scent but very limited since the Body Shop has only done it in body products.
It’s nice some of their classic scents are now available in a fragrance mist. Lucky enough the scent hasn’t morphed in this format as you know fragrances go a little different when they are turned into a mist or perfume. But the Body Shop successfully captured Satsuma brilliantly. You get that crisp bitter edge of citrus mixed with the juicy, succulence of orange and clementine.
The mist is strong at first spritz but dries down to sweet, mellow sunshine. It has a three hour wear time before needing a touch up.
I wanted a longer wear time but overall for $12 I’m quite loving these body mists and will indulge in a few more. And of course, you always have the option to layer now!
